The following table provides summary statistics for contract job vacancies advertised in London with a requirement for KVM skills. Included is a benchmarking guide to the contractor rates offered in vacancies that have cited KVM over the 6 months to 28 April 2024 with a comparison to the same period in the previous 2 years.

6 months to
28 Apr 2024
Same period 2023 Same period 2022
Rank 376 487 594
Rank change year-on-year +111 +107 -162
Contract jobs citing KVM 18 14 10
As % of all contract jobs advertised in London 0.10% 0.052% 0.026%
As % of the System Software category 1.02% 0.44% 0.19%
Number of daily rates quoted 10 2 9
10th Percentile £540 £391 £465
25th Percentile £553 £397 £513
Median daily rate (50th Percentile) £650 £438 £610
Median % change year-on-year +48.57% -28.28% +16.19%
75th Percentile £738 £472 £638
90th Percentile £750 £474 £650
England median daily rate £563 £450 £525
% change year-on-year +25.00% -14.29% -4.55%
